What are Porcelain Veneers?
Do you hide your teeth when you speak or take photos? Have you always wished you had a perfect, bright, and natural smile? If so, you might be a good candidate for Porcelain Veneers.
Porcelain Veneers, also referred to as Porcelain Laminates or simply Veneers, are a thin, customized layer of porcelain that is permanently applied to the tooth surface in order to achieve ideal esthetic results. This is done by permanently covering the surfaces of selected teeth. Veneers can be placed to change the color of the teeth if they are discolored due to diet, genetics, age, or root canal treatment. They can also improve the shape and size of the teeth in cases of wear, chips, cracks, fractures, and malformations. In addition, Veneers can be used to improve the alignment of teeth in cases of crowding or spacing.
The procedure involves an initial consultation where the treatment goals are discussed. This would involve exploring the patient’s options and making a decision about the number of teeth to be veneered. Then, planning the specific changes to be made to the appearance of the smile. The following visit would involve reshaping the teeth in order to allow space for the thickness of the Veneers and taking an impression of the teeth.
At this visit, temporary veneers will be placed. This will provide a test-run for the patient to try out the veneers and having the opportunity to make changes to the shape and length of the teeth prior to finalizing the design. The final appointment would involve removing the temporaries and cementing the Porcelain Veneers.
